Biostatistics Sr Manager_

Rockville

**Position Summary:**

The primary role of this position is to provide statistical support for multiple clinical studies across all phases of clinical development. Apply statistical principles and techniques to a wide range of problems within the clinical development environment with the supervision of more senior staff.

**Responsibilities:**

+ Support biostatistical activities for Clinical Development, Clinical Operations, Medical Affairs, and Business Development

+ Provide statistical expertise and leadership to ensure program objectives are in alignment with regulatory and commercial needs

+ Serve as primary author for statistical sections of protocol

+ Create accompanying statistical documents (e.g., statistical analysis plan and mocked shells)

+ Participate in development of EDC database and interactive response technology (IxRS) specifications

+ Collaborate with project management, regulatory, medical affairs, PV/safety, business development, and commercial functions

+ Implement innovative statistical techniques that will provide benefit to clinical development programs

+ Contribute to strategic planning and go/no go decision guidance

+ Review biostatistics and statistical programming tasks outsourced to vendors

+ Perform statistical analyses and create statistical text for clinical publications and other communications, perform SAS programming validation if needed

+ Support the preparation of regulatory submissions documents including summaries of clinical safety and efficacy of BLA/NDAs if needed

+ Ensure timeliness and quality of deliverables

+ Travel as needed to execute assigned responsibilities.

**BASIC** **QUALIFICATIONS**

Doctorate degree and 2 years of experience OR Master’s degree and 6 years of experience OR Bachelor’s degree and 8 years of experience OR Associate’s degree and 10 years of experience OR High school diploma / GED and 12 years of experience

**PREFERRED QUALIFICATIUONS**

+ Doctorate degree in biostatistics and at least 4 years of post-graduate statistical experience in the pharmaceutical industry or medical research _Or_

+ Master’s degree in biostatistics and at least 8 years of post-graduate statistical experience in the pharmaceutical industry or medical research _._

+ Life Cycle Drug Development Experience (Pre-clinical Development, Clinical Development, and Post-marketing)

+ Strong verbal and written communication combined with organizational skills and cross-cultural sensitivity

+ Statistical leadership and contribution to regulatory and reimbursement submissions. of regulatory guidelines.

+ Experience working effectively in a globally dispersed team environment with cross-cultural partners.
